For more * information on the Apache Software Foundation, please see * <http://www.apache.org/>. */ package org.jboss.axis.utils; import java.io.ByteArrayOutputStream; import java.io.FileInputStream; import java.io.FileNotFoundException; import java.io.IOException; import java.io.InputStream; /** * Class loader for JWS files. There is one of these per JWS class, and * we keep a static Hashtable of them, indexed by class name. When we want * to reload a JWS, we replace the ClassLoader for that class and let the * old one get GC'ed. * * @author Glen Daniels (gdaniels@apache.org) * @author Doug Davis (dug@us.ibm.com) */ public class JWSClassLoader extends ClassLoader { private String classFile = null; private String name = null; /** * Construct a JWSClassLoader with a class name, a parent ClassLoader, * and a filename of a .class file containing the bytecode for the class. * The constructor will load the bytecode, define the class, and register * this JWSClassLoader in the static registry. * * @param name the name of the class which will be created/loaded * @param cl the parent ClassLoader * @param classFile filename of the .class file * @throws FileNotFoundException * @throws IOException */ public JWSClassLoader(String name, ClassLoader cl, String classFile) throws FileNotFoundException, IOException { super(cl); this.name = name + ".class"; this.classFile = classFile; FileInputStream fis = new FileInputStream(classFile); ByteArrayOutputStream baos = new ByteArrayOutputStream(); byte buf[] = new byte[1024]; for (int i = 0; (i = fis.read(buf)) != -1;) baos.write(buf, 0, i); fis.close(); baos.close(); /* Create a new Class object from it */ /*************************************/ byte[] data = baos.toByteArray(); defineClass(name, data, 0, data.length); ClassUtils.setClassLoader(name, this); } /** * Overloaded getResourceAsStream() so we can be sure to return the * correct class file regardless of where it might live on our hard * drive. * * @param resourceName the resource to load (should be "classname.class") * @return an InputStream of the class bytes, or null */ public InputStream getResourceAsStream(String resourceName) { try { if (resourceName.equals(name)) return new FileInputStream(classFile); } catch (FileNotFoundException e) { // Fall through, return null. } return null; } }
